Use of (identified) fragmentation functions

pp collisions

◮ Extract information about the non-perturbative fragmentation process ◮ Reference for more complex systems

p–Pb collisions

◮ No medium formed ◮ Study influence of a nucleus (= cold nuclear matter)

Pb–Pb collisions

◮ Presence of a medium changes the jet ◮ Mechanism: e.g. jet quenching ◮ Theory predicts higher baryon and strangeness production in the

presence of a medium

Jet Reconstruction

This analysis: charged jets Input: charged tracks

◮ pT > 0.15 GeV/c ◮ |η| < 0.9

Jet reconstruction done with anti-kT-algorithm with resolution parameter R = 0.4 →gives jets with circular cones of radius R Only jets fully contained in acceptance: |ηjet| <0.9 - R

Occupancy effects in the TPC

Mean dE/dx changes due to occupancy effects in the TPC with the multiplicity

◮ Parametrized with linear fit ◮ Slope of parametrization depends on η and dE/dx - dependency is

parametrized

Challenges:

◮ The fit of the mean dE/dx is challenging ◮ Shape of detector response changes → not parametrized

Underlying Event

Underlying Event: Particles in the reconstructed jet not coming from the original parton Important in pPb and especially in PbPb pjet

T must be corrected

◮ area of jet is measured with ghost particles ◮ UE momentum density measured using kT jet-algorithm -> median

without the two leading jets gives the momentum density

◮ resulting UE momentum is subtracted jet-by-jet

particle yield of the UE must be subtracted from jet particle yield → shown in the next slides

Underlying Event Estimation

Assume: Equally distributed in φ Clone each jet cone and place it in the event

◮ Random Cones (RC,

systematics)

ηUEcone = ηjet ϕUEcone drawn randomly from [0, 2π], outside other jet cones

◮ Perpendicular Cones (PC,

standard)

ηUEcone = ηjet ϕ±

UEcone = ϕjet ± π/2.0

Estimate yield of particles in UE cones → UE yield

90◦ 90◦
